UCM president appeals for use of handloom fabric to tailor school uniforms
Source: The Sangai Express
Imphal, August 31 2022:
United Committee Manipur (UCM) in association with the Agriculture Department organised a one day farmers' training programme on 'Rejuvenation of Farm Economy' along with distribution of urea and seeds of Rabi crops at Irengbam Awang Leikai in Bishnupur district today.
The programme was attended by I Gopen, Pradhan, Irengbam GP; Joychandra Konthoujam, president UCM and Th Landhoni, Member, Irengbam GP as the presidium members.
Speaking on the occasion, Joychandra Konthoujam shared that after agriculture, handloom and handicrafts contribute the most to the State economy.
As such, citing Chief Minister N Biren Singh's alleged statement to use handloom and handicraft products across all department offices in the State, he urged for actualisation of the same.
Further, he called for the use of handloom fabrics to tailor school uniforms.
The UCM president also appealed to the State administration to ban import of mass mill-produced cloths imitating the handloom products of local weavers as these pose a serious concern to the economic standing of the weavers of the State.
Lastly, he appealed for revival of the Manipur Spinning Mill.
The programme was also attended by L Rameshwor, Agriculture Officer, Bishnupur and S Bidyarani, representative, ATMA Bishnupur, who further delivered insightful lectures as resource persons.
